I have always used wireless controllers on my 360, but just recently I bought an off-brand (TSZ) wired 360 controller, because I wanted a controller that I could use on PC as well as 360. Unfortunately it won't work except it can turn my 360 on when I press the "guide" button but it is never recognized as a controller and all four lights keep flashing on the gamepad.

Btw no luck on PC...I am wondering if its broken. :(

The 360 is programmed to only recognise genuine 360 controllers and approved third party controllers - that's why if you plug in any random controller it won't work.

If the controller you were sold was designed for 360 then it should work. It could be faulty, or just not something approved by MS for the 360. The fact it doesn't work on your PC makes me suspect the controller is faulty.
